Origin and History

Cinnamon rolls, with their distinctive spiral shape, trace their roots to Sweden in the early 19th century. Known as “kanelbullar,” these sweet buns became a staple of Swedish fika, a social gathering centered around coffee and pastries.

Scrolls, on the other hand, originated in Australia in the 1800s. Inspired by European pastries, Australian bakers created their own version, characterized by a rectangular shape and cinnamon-sugar filling.

Differences

While they share some similarities, cinnamon rolls and scrolls also have distinct differences:

  • Shape: Cinnamon rolls are typically shaped into spirals, while scrolls are rectangular.
  • Filling Distribution: Cinnamon rolls have a more evenly distributed filling throughout the spiral, whereas scrolls have a thicker layer of filling in the center.
  • Frosting: Traditional cinnamon rolls are often topped with a cream cheese frosting, while scrolls are typically unfrosted.
  • Texture: Cinnamon rolls tend to have a more flaky texture due to the layers of dough, while scrolls have a softer, more cake-like texture.
